Packaging Channel Leader

The Impact You’ll Make in this Role

As aPackaging Channel Leader, you will have the opportunity to tap into your curiosity and collaborate with some of the most innovative people around the world. Here, you will make an impact by:

  • Deliver financial expectations for SD 100034 (Sales Growth, Margin, etc.) and PC 2650 Packaging to Operating Plan
  • Build, grow and manage a world class channel sales and marketing team.
  • Develop and implement the channel strategy for packaging products in the US and Canada.
  • Build and maintain strong relationships with key channel partners, including distributors and resellers
  • Collaborate with sales, marketing, and product development teams to ensure alignment and drive revenue growth.
  • Monitor and analyze market trends, competitor activities, and customer needs to identify opportunities for growth.
  • Develop and execute channel marketing programs and promotions to drive demand and increase market share.
  • Provide training and support to channel partners to ensure they have the knowledge and resources needed to effectively sell our products.
  • Monitor channel performance and provide regular reports to senior management.
  • Identify and resolve any issues or challenges that may arise within the channel.

Your Skills and Expertise

To set you up for success in this role from day one, 3M requires (at a minimum) the following q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in Business, Marketing, or a related field (completed and verified prior to start)
  • Eight (8) years in B2B Sales and marketing rolesin a private, public, government or military environment

Additional qualifications that could help you succeed even further in this role include:

  • MBA preferred.
  • Five (5) years of experience in channel management, preferably in the packaging industry.
  • Proven track record of developing and executing successful channel strategies.
  • Strong leadership and team management skills.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to analyze market data and develop actionable insights.
  • Strong problem-solving skills and the ability to think strategically.
  • Willingness to travel as needed.
